About this book

The LinkedIn advantage for consultants and freelancers: how to build a personal brand on LinkedIn, write a profile that does sales work, and turn a small B2B audience into qualified inbound leads and revenue in 2026.

In March 2024 a fractional CFO named Daniel Reyes sent Sasha Vance a one-line message: "I've been posting on LinkedIn for six months and I have nothing to show for it." Two hundred eighty-three followers. Ninety-one posts. Zero qualified leads. Six months later, after he stopped writing for the algorithm, Daniel had closed three engagements worth $186,000 in combined annual contract value β€” on fewer than half the posts. This is the working manual behind that turnaround.

Written by a consultant who has built businesses on LinkedIn for nine years, this is a LinkedIn marketing book for the professional who has actual work to do. It treats LinkedIn as a sales platform with a content interface bolted on, not a follower-count game. You will learn LinkedIn lead generation that produces traceable outcomes: a discovery call that becomes a contract, a quiet DM from a stranger who has read your stuff for a year. The book covers your profile, headline, and About section, a posting cadence you can sustain for years, comments as a distribution engine, cold DM outreach without being a spammer, and the sales conversation that starts in the DMs.

Inside this LinkedIn marketing and personal branding book:

  • The profile that sells while you sleep β€” Turn the storefront (banner, headline, About, Featured) into a quiet salesperson; one 20-minute banner change tripled a client's conversation rate
  • The headline that earns the click β€” Four real headlines dissected, and why "Open to Opportunities" and "Founder & CEO of [just you]" quietly cost you $20,000-a-month buyers
  • An About section that reads like a person wrote it β€” Open with who you serve, describe the shape of the engagement, and use negative selection instead of AI-generated "ecosystem" filler
  • The first 200 followers β€” Two weeks of fifteen to twenty manual, specific connection requests to build a starter audience by name, not engagement pods or follow-back games
  • Comments as the quiet distribution engine β€” How borrowed distribution from ten to twenty creators turned one copywriter's inbound from zero to three qualified inquiries a week
  • DM outreach and the sales conversation β€” Three to five DMs a week off a named list of fifty buyers, and how to move a promising thread to a discovery call instead of letting it peter out
  • Measuring what matters and a 30-day starter plan β€” Track conversation quality, not likes, plus a profile audit checklist, sample posts, and a month-by-month companion for year one

This is not a guide to growing your follower count or becoming a thought leader. It is a LinkedIn for business playbook for the consultant, freelancer, or professional services firm who wants a small, specific audience of people who already half-trust you by the time they reach out. Do the work for six months and the conversations in your inbox get better; do it for three years and you have an asset that produces inbound business for as long as you tend it.

For readers of Wayne Breitbarth's The Power Formula for LinkedIn Success and William Arruda's Own Your Brand on LinkedIn.
